My name is Rick Bartholomew and I have been a Hayward resident for 44 years. I have been a homeowner in Hayward for 28 years. My lovely wife, Jen, and I have been married for 12 wonderful years. Jen is a former elementary school teacher. I have two sons, who both attend Hayward Schools. My youngest attends East Avenue Elementary; my oldest attends Bret Harte Middle school. I have always been and continue to be an involved parent. My philosophy has been that an open relationship with the teacher, the student, and the parent is the true key to a successful education. I have been on many committees at each school. At East Avenue I have been on the School Site Council, I was a safety chairman, became part of a Citizen Emergency Response Team, and was on a nutritional lunch task force and currently I am the PTA's Parliamentarian. At Bret Harte I am currently on a parent task force, am the treasurer of the PTA, am the treasurer of the Band Booster Club and have graduated from the Parent Institute for QualityEducation.
I am also involved in my community. I helped teach my son's seventh grade Faith Formation class at All Saints Church and will be teaching my son's eighth grade class this year. I was chosen to serve on the Budget Advisory Task Force by the District Office. My next involvement is what I believe was the deciding factor for me to run for the Hayward School Board and that was my involvement with the Measure I Bond. When I started getting involved in trying to pass what I thought was a very critical Bond for our schools, I became excited to think this could be the beginning of something big for Hayward, a much needed investment. When Measure I passed with such a strong showing I knew I was part of a forward movement and wanted to continue that movement by being a voice for the parents and teachers as a member of the School Board.
